Description

Powys Teaching Health Board require a contractor for the competent person inspection on the pressure systems and lifting equipment at PTHB. These must adhere to PER, PSSR and LOLER as a minimum. The full details are outlined with the tender documents attached within Bravo. The tender will be awarded to the most advantageous tender based on 40% quality and 60% cost as detailed in the ITT document. Please note that the tender closing date is 8th of July 2026 at midday and any late submissions will not be considered.
